Kensington Place — Gardens
$$$ Upscale
★ 9.1

An intimate hillside retreat of just eight rooms in the suburb of Higgovale, Kensington Place offers sweeping views of the city bowl and the Atlantic, with pool-terrace breakfasts to rival any five-star.

The Silo Hotel — V&A Waterfront
$$$$ Ultra-luxury
★ 9.8

V&A Waterfront

The Silo Hotel

Housed in the converted grain elevator above the Zeitz MOCAA museum, The Silo is Cape Town's most architecturally extraordinary hotel — 28 rooms, pillow-bulge windows, and the city's best rooftop bar.

Belmond Mount Nelson Hotel — Gardens
$$$$ Ultra-luxury
★ 9.3

The 'Pink Lady' has welcomed dignitaries since 1899. Set in nine acres of formal gardens at the foot of Table Mountain, this grande dame remains Cape Town's most iconic address — famed for its legendary afternoon tea.

Tintswalo Atlantic — Camps Bay
$$$$ Ultra-luxury
★ 9.5

Perched on the rocks of Hout Bay Harbour with the Atlantic crashing beneath your suite, Tintswalo Atlantic is one of South Africa's most extraordinary small hotels — 10 suites, each themed on an African island.

Ellerman House — Camps Bay
$$$$ Ultra-luxury
★ 9.7

A magnificent Edwardian villa on the Atlantic seaboard cliffs, Ellerman House blends Old World grandeur with one of South Africa's finest private art collections. Just 13 suites, impeccable service.

When is the best time to visit Cape Town?

Cape Town's best months are November through April, when the Cape summers bring warm, dry days perfect for beaches and outdoor dining. The shoulder months of March–April and October–November offer great weather with thinner crowds.
